Innocent Ujah Idibia (born Innocent Ujah Idibia) was born in Nigeria on September 18, 1975, and is better known by his stage name 2Baba.
Advertisement
He is a pop star, recording artist, entrepreneur, philanthropist, humanitarian, and activist from Nigeria.
Advertisement